Vehicle flees traffic stop near Midway and FaradayPort Charlotte FL

audio iconTraffic
Meehan Ave, Port Charlotte, FL 33952

A vehicle failed to stop for a traffic officer near Midway and Faraday. The driver fled the area, discarding items during the pursuit. The vehicle was later found parked on Meehan Avenue in Port Charlotte.
